JPMAM appoints head of global liquidity EMEA

J.P. Morgan Asset Management has appointed Jim Fuell as head of global liquidity EMEA, overseeing sales for continental Europe and the UK.

Fuell has worked for JPMAM since 2006 as part of the global liquidity team in London. Prior to this he worked for Deutsche Bank’s Global Banking business in Tokyo and has held corporate banking roles at both Citibank and the Bank of Tokyo Mitsubishi, in New York and Tokyo respectively.  

In his new role he will report directly head of global liquidity Robert Deutsch.

Deutsche said: “The international liquidity fund market continues to grow and it is excellent to see that the growth within our own institutional liquidity business reflects this demand."
